We are currently looking to recruit a Fitter to construct, maintain and repair the electrical distribution network. This is an important role within the district, where you’ll provide key skills and knowledge to ready the network for an electric future and to help meet the challenge of Net Zero across more than 100,000km of network and 30,000 substations, benefiting more than 3.5m homes and businesses across Scotland, England, and Wales.

All training, tools and PPE will be provided when working towards Company Authorisation and once Authorised. The opportunity of a standby position could be made available when fully trained and authorised to work on the network, depending on business requirements.

What you’ll be doing
  • Ensure all site works are carried out safely, following company policy and safety regulations.
  • Act as the designated safety lead during works attended.
  • Perform maintenance and repairs on circuit breakers, batteries, and transformers within substations or workshop environments.
  • Drain and replenish oils, including handling residual carbon deposits in a controlled manner.
  • Follow assigned work procedures and adhere to health and safety protocols at all times.
  • Conduct tasks at height, utilising collective safety measures (e.g., guard rails) and personal protective equipment (e.g., safety harnesses, fall arrest systems) when required.
  • Assess environmental factors, ground conditions, and weather conditions to determine the safest work methods.
  • Plan and execute tasks efficiently, working independently or as part of a collaborative team.
  • Maintain a proactive and safety-conscious approach, ensuring high operational standards.
  • Deliver exceptional service, supporting essential operations 24/7/365 to benefit local communities.
  • Exhibit strong attention to detail, alongside excellent oral and written communication skills.
What you’ll bring
  • Demonstrable experience and a strong understanding of the network.
  • Previous experience in a utilities business is desirable but not essential.
  • Sound knowledge of health, safety, and environmental legislation to ensure compliance and safe working practices.
  • Excellent communication skills to engage effectively with colleagues and customers as a professional on-site representative of the company.
Minimum Requirements
  • City & Guilds or NVQ equivalent, and/or equivalent experience.
  • Current or previous employment as an Electrical/Mechanical Fitter.
  • Valid driving licence.

Why SP Energy Networks

SP Energy Networks is part of the Iberdrola Group, one of the world’s largest integrated utility companies and a world leader in wind energy. We keep electricity flowing to homes and businesses through Central and Southern Scotland, North Wales and in the North West of England. We operate over 4000km of cables and lines that make-up the transmission network – connecting infrastructure like wind farms into the electricity system. It’s a role that puts us right at the heart of Scotland’s ambition to be Net Zero by 2044. And we’re taking it very seriously. We’re investing >£5.5 billion into our transmission network, directly supporting the rapid growth needed in renewable energy.
